Buying Guide for the Best Bottom Load Water Dispensers With Ice Maker

Choosing the right bottom-load water dispenser with an ice maker can significantly enhance your convenience and hydration experience. These appliances combine the benefits of easy water bottle replacement with the added luxury of having ice readily available. To make an informed decision, it's important to understand the key specifications and how they align with your needs. Here are the main factors to consider when selecting the best model for you.
Water CapacityWater capacity refers to the amount of water the dispenser can hold and dispense. This is important because it determines how often you will need to replace the water bottle. Typically, dispensers accommodate standard 3 or 5-gallon bottles. If you have a large family or use a lot of water, a 5-gallon capacity might be more suitable to reduce the frequency of bottle changes. For smaller households or less frequent use, a 3-gallon capacity could be sufficient.
Ice Production RateThe ice production rate indicates how much ice the machine can produce within a 24-hour period. This is crucial if you frequently use ice for drinks or other purposes. Ice production rates can vary widely, from around 20 pounds to over 50 pounds per day. If you entertain often or have a high demand for ice, opt for a higher production rate. For occasional use, a lower production rate will suffice.
Ice Storage CapacityIce storage capacity refers to the amount of ice the dispenser can store at one time. This is important because it affects how much ice is readily available before the machine needs to produce more. Storage capacities can range from a few pounds to over 20 pounds. If you need a constant supply of ice, look for a model with a larger storage capacity. For less frequent use, a smaller storage capacity will be adequate.
Filtration SystemA filtration system ensures that the water and ice are clean and free from impurities. This is important for health and taste. Some dispensers come with built-in filtration systems, while others may require you to purchase filters separately. If water quality is a concern, choose a model with a high-quality filtration system. Consider how often the filters need to be replaced and the cost of replacements as well.
Ease of UseEase of use encompasses features like intuitive controls, easy bottle loading, and maintenance requirements. This is important for ensuring that the dispenser is user-friendly and convenient. Look for models with clear instructions, easy-to-reach controls, and simple maintenance procedures. If you have mobility issues or prefer minimal effort, prioritize dispensers with ergonomic designs and straightforward operation.
Energy EfficiencyEnergy efficiency refers to how much electricity the dispenser uses to operate. This is important for both environmental impact and your electricity bill. Energy-efficient models will have lower operating costs and are better for the environment. Look for dispensers with energy-saving features or certifications. If you are conscious about energy consumption, choose a model that balances performance with efficiency.
Noise LevelNoise level indicates how loud the dispenser is during operation. This is important if you plan to place the dispenser in a quiet environment like an office or bedroom. Noise levels can vary, with some models being almost silent and others producing noticeable sound. If noise is a concern, look for models specifically designed to operate quietly. For less noise-sensitive areas, this may be a less critical factor.
